Ticket: Staging env misconfigured for Siftgate bloom filter

The bloom layer in front of the Pellet KV store is rejecting all lookups in staging because the env file was copied from the dev template without credentials. False-positive tuning values are fine; only the auth line is missing. To unblock the weekly demo, the Pellet admission secret must be set on the following line.

env line for yaguf-fajop: LEDGER_TOKEN13=fb08984397349

Subject: On-call prep — tailcat

Welcome to the rotation. Quick note before Thursday's sync: use tailcat for log tailing, not raw SSH. It handles auth, multiplexes across the Brindlewood cluster, and respects redaction filters. Flags you'll need: --service, --since, and --grep. Don't pipe output to shared channels; paging rules apply. Install via the standard toolchain bootstrap. Full command reference and setup steps are on the internal page below.

wiki page, bagaf-fawip: https://harbor.tolvaqsys.local/pages/repo/pages/secrets/eac969ffc71f356b

# Catalogue import env for the Hollis-Fenwick library sync.
# The Shelfwright importer pulls nightly MARC batches from the
# Dunmoor archive mirror and normalizes them into the Lantern DB.
# Reviewers: keep BATCH_SIZE at 500; larger batches trip the
# mirror's rate guard and the import silently truncates.
# IMPORT_MODE=merge is required after the dedupe fix in v2.3.
# The mirror now requires authenticated pulls, so set the mirror
# credential on the very next line.

env line for fafof-fahag: LEDGER_TOKEN5=f8790

### Session tokens not refreshing? Read this first.

Welcome aboard! On Brindlework staging, session tokens sometimes fail to refresh because the Oxfell cache holds the old expiry. Quick fix: flush the cache key for the affected session, then retry the refresh call. If it still fails, it's probably clock drift on the worker. To reproduce the refresh call yourself, use the token below.

session JWT of yawep-yawep = eyJhbGciOiJIUzI1NiIsInR5cCI6IkpXVCJ9.eyJzdWIiOiI3pWF3_In0.aXYsHiog